4. "vampires will always be endlessly fascinating"
In response to Reply # 2


  

          

especially if the way they're portrayed is constantly evolving over time from simple cold killers (all the old shit), to vampires with souls (Buffy/Angel) & vampires who are just regular folk and want to be normal (True Blood). i was constantly fascinated by Angel & Spike (from the Buffyverse) cos they explored what it means to have a moral compass and still be a bloodsucking 'demon'. True Blood puts vampires in the same class as traditionally persecuted minority groups as well as displaying the more traditional predator side too.

i mean the concept of a vampire is always intriguing and interesting, especially when it's in the hands of such talents like Joss Whedon or Alan Ball (or even Anne Rice to a degree). if you make it interesting enough, it's a cool concept that will never die. it's like re-inventing Batman over and over.

you could make the same case for zombies too, but i've never really seen anyone take zombies too seriously and really..uh, flesh out what it is to be one, cos they're always portrayed as completely devoid of intellect. whereas a vampire has the same intelligence as a human, if not more, and an audience will always be able to relate to them (once again, especially if the story, the characters and the writing in general are fantastic).

35. "Vampires are sexy, cheap"
In response to Reply # 0


          

That's basically it.

Vampires are Hollywood: sex, violence, an alluring fantasy world. Unlike other monsters, they give you everything you need for a movie right there. On top of that, they can be made fairly cheaply. You just need some fangs. You can go overboard or add more effects but it's a lot easier to pull off than a werewolf.

Also, Hollywood doesn't like originality so it's a lot harder to sell a "new" monster. People will think, "Oh it's a monster movie." and immediately think it's a b-movie. Vampires have a proven track record and zombies got a push of late when 28 Days Later and Dawn of the Dead made good money at the box office.
